B. Where They Are Being Trafficked

The sex trafficking of Native women and girls does not follow any predominant geographic pattern. Advocates in Minnesota and Washington report trafficking of Native women from reservation to reservation, off reservations to cities within the region, and wholly within reservations. Given the large number of American Indians living in urban centers today, much sex trafficking is city to city or wholly within a city. Advocates in Minnesota also report trafficking from reservations onto boats moored at the Port of Duluth on Lake Superior.
